Boire ou coder ... Pourquoi choisir?
Publié le 08 décembre 2008 00:00

Configurer Symfony 1.2 pour MySQL

Ayant, en ce moment, un peu de temps pour cela, j'en profite pour regarder un petit peu à quoi ressemble Symfony. Je ferai donc probablement quelques articles à ce propos ici dans les jours à venir.

Si vous lisez cette documentation, vous constaterez qu'ils indiquent de placer le "dsn" suivant dans votre configuration : mysql://root:pass@localhost/database

Cependant la nouvelle version de Propel force une légère modification de cette configuration. Il nous faut donc modifier le "dsn" en : mysql:dbname=database;host=localhost

Tous les autres paramètres peuvent être conservé de manière similaire. Cependant, si vous n'avez pas une application "from scratch", vous devez, pour mettre à jour depuis la 1.1, suivez les conseils de mise à jour donnés sur cette page.

Commentaires

thoas
thoas dit: 08 décembre 2008 00:00

Effectivement, tu fais bien de le souligner leur page "my first project" n'est pas à jour pour la 1.2 et donc configure le tout pour du Propel1.2 (Creole).

Cependant, je pense que tout ceci est largement compensé par l'élaboration du tutoriel Jobeet.

Je serais intéressé par la comparaison que tu feras (sans doute) avec RoR étant donnée que, pour moi, symfony reste le framework le plus élaboré en PHP.

Apparemment, tu as finis par choper pdo_mysql ;)

Damien
Damien dit: 08 décembre 2008 00:00 Site web

Effectivement j'ai résolu le problème de PDO en utilisant MAMP au lieu du PHP fourni de base avec Mac OS.

Pour la comparaison, on verra quand je maitriserai bien le framework ;)

Hugo
Hugo dit: 03 janvier 2009 00:00 Site web

Je suis actuellement entrain de réécrire entièrement le "My First Project" pour symfony 1.2. Le tutorial changera également de nom et de thème car le "My First Project" n'est pas forcément adapté pour débuter.

Postez un commentaire

Markdown activé